I wholeheartedly agreed with David N. Moffat where he wrote that UNBC should not discriminate against conservatives.
I believe our university should be active in recruiting conservative students.
When I entered university I was a rabid conservative.
My favourite author was Ayn Rand. I was a critic of social security as a symptom of the hated "creeping socialism." By the time I completed four years of exposure to a wider world of ideas I was a socialist myself.
Exposure to education does not always work this way, but students of all stripes should be exposed to new ideas so within four years they can choose their own politics rather than mindlessly adopt those of their elders.
